Cost of Residential Roof Replacement in Norwich, CT

Residential roof replacement projects in Norwich, CT, typically vary in cost depending on several factors including the scope of work, choice of materials, labor requirements, and site-specific conditions. While basic replacements may be more affordable, complex projects involving high-end materials or challenging access can increase overall expenses. Understanding these variables can help homeowners better estimate potential costs and plan accordingly.

Final pricing for roof replacement services often depends on the size of the roof, the type of roofing materials selected, and any additional work such as repairs or reinforcement needed due to existing damage. Site conditions, such as accessibility and weather considerations, can also influence the overall project cost. Comparing different options and obtaining detailed estimates can assist in making informed decisions about residential roof replacement in Norwich, CT.

Key Factors Affecting Costs

Residential roof replacement in Norwich, CT, involves removing existing roofing materials and installing a new roof to protect the home from the elements.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ners anticipate costs and compare options effectively.

  • Materials: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, or architectural shingles, chosen based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
  • Size and Scope: Projects vary depending on the roof's square footage, complexity of design, and additional features like dormers or skylights.
  • Labor Complexity: Roofs with multiple layers, steep pitches, or intricate layouts may require more extensive labor and specialized skills.
  • Permitting: Local permits are typically necessary in Norwich, CT, to ensure compliance with building codes and regulations.
  • Extras: Additional work may include replacing flashing, installing new gutters, or upgrading ventilation systems to enhance roof performance.

Project Size and Material Scope

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small roof (1,000 sq ft or less) $8,000 - $12,000
Medium roof (1,000 - 2,000 sq ft) $12,000 - $20,000
Large roof (2,000 - 3,000 sq ft) $20,000 - $30,000
Complex designs or additional features Varies, often higher

In Norwich, CT, the cost of residential roof replacement can vary based on roof size, material choice, and roof complexity, with local factors influencing overall expenses.
